Melody is the sweet tale of a 12-year-old blind girl, set in 19th-century New England. Originally published in 1893, it is the first of Laura E. Richards' “Melody” series, the rest of which are Marie (1894), “Bethesda Pool” (1895), and Rosin the Beau (1898). The Milwaukee Sentinel said of Melody: “The quaintly pretty, touching, old-fashioned story is told with perfect grace; the few persons who belong to it are touched in with distinctness and with sympathy.” This edition, with original illustrations by Frank T. Merrill, was adapted from 19th-century print versions in the public domain, and edited to more closely conform to modern American spelling and punctuation. Its layout and type have been designed for ease of reading for both adults and children.
